Finite Element Analysis of Different Screw Path after Femoral Neck Fracture Healing

Abstract:Objective To investigate the stress distribution of different screw path of proximal femur after femoral neck fracture healing with removal of cannulated screws so as to provide theoretical reference for rehabilitation and prevention of complications after surgery.Methods Dimensional finite element model of the human proximal femur was reconstructed by 64-slice spiral CT scan.Finite element model of equilateral triangle and inverted triangle screw path were established respectively.Under the same load and constraint,the von stresses of the femural in different models were compared by the finite element analysis.Results The maximum von stress were concentrated in the region of calcar under the femoral neck.The maximum von stress of equilateral triangle model (11.02 MPa) was much larger than inverted triangle model(10.82 MPa) and normal proximal femur model (10.58 MPa).Conclusion The stress of femur neck would increase significantly after equilateral triangle screws were removed.It was needed to pay close attention to risk of femoral neck fracture when did rehabilitation and functional exercises after surgery.
